Title: Characterization of ether electrolytes for rechargeable lithium cells. Technical report

2Methyl-tetrahydrofuran (2Me-THF)/LiAsF/sub 6/ and several diethyl ether (DEE)/LiAsF/sub 6/-based electrolytes have been characterized for their usefulness in rechargeable Li/TiS/sub 2/ cells. This characterization has involved extended room temperature cell cycling at various depths of discharge, evaluation of rate/capacity behavior of cells at 25C and -10C, and storage of cells at 50C for up to one month with subsequent cycling. The thermal stability of the electrolytes at 71C was evaluated by storage experiments in sealed-tubes, followed by product analysis. The performance of 2Me-THF/LiAsF/sub 6/ cells far surpassed the others. The present data further substantiate previous reports from this laboratory of the superior behavior of 2Me-THF/LiAsF/sub 6/ solutions in rechargeable Li cells. The DEE/LiAsF/sub 6/ based electrolytes are too unstable thermally to be practically useful.
